On the removed medieval knight chapter from Eternal Darkness:

Dyack: This section of the game was removed and rewritten because of 9/11 unfortunately. Anything to do with crusaders at the time was considered to risky and the game was almost cancelled because of this. Thankfully, we were able to change it in time. This change delayed the launch for the GameCube, but we were able to do it and get the game released.

On moving Eternal Darkness from the N64 to GameCube:

Dyack: Well we created a new engine for the GameCube version but it ran 480p without a extra memory - it was a technical very difficult to get that to work but it did.

On creating the game in general and something he wanted to change:

Dyack: It was a great experience putting it together. The end game was on track with the original vision considering technology updates. We wanted to create a game were lots of people were going to die. :) ...I wanted to balance the magick economy more and not have it simply refresh over time.

On the size of the Eternal Darkness universe:

Dyack: There is more too it. The universe design for ED is vast and there are so many more stories to tell.

Mr. Dyack also stated that he would love to work on a new Eternal Darkness for Wii U or 3DS if Nintendo asked him to. That was just his own personal interest, as nothing has been formally requested by Nintendo. Huge thanks to Trojanhorse711 for the heads up!
